bool IRaySegmentsCollidable.TryGetRayCollision(Body thisBody, Body raysBody, RaySegmentsShape raySegments, out RaySegmentIntersectionInfo info)
        {
            bool intersects = false;

            RaySegment[] segments = raySegments.Segments;
            Scalar[]     result   = new Scalar[segments.Length];
            Scalar       temp;

            Vector2D[][] polygons = this.Polygons;
            for (int index = 0; index < segments.Length; ++index)
            {
                result[index] = -1;
            }
            Matrix2x3 matrix = raysBody.Matrices.ToBody * thisBody.Matrices.ToWorld;

            for (int polyIndex = 0; polyIndex < polygons.Length; ++polyIndex)
            {
                Vector2D[] unTrans = polygons[polyIndex];
                Vector2D[] polygon = new Vector2D[unTrans.Length];
                for (int index = 0; index < unTrans.Length; ++index)
                {
                    Vector2D.Transform(ref matrix, ref unTrans[index], out polygon[index]);
                }
                BoundingRectangle rect;
                BoundingRectangle.FromVectors(polygon, out rect);
                BoundingPolygon poly = new BoundingPolygon(polygon);
                for (int index = 0; index < segments.Length; ++index)
                {
                    RaySegment segment = segments[index];
                    rect.Intersects(ref segment.RayInstance, out temp);
                    if (temp >= 0 && temp <= segment.Length)
                    {
                        poly.Intersects(ref segment.RayInstance, out temp);
                        if (temp >= 0 && temp <= segment.Length)
                        {
                            if (result[index] == -1 || temp < result[index])
                            {
                                result[index] = temp;
                            }
                            intersects = true;
                        }
                    }
                }
            }
            if (intersects)
            {
                info = new RaySegmentIntersectionInfo(result);
            }
            else
            {
                info = null;
            }
            return(intersects);
        }
